What Are Tanning Bed Intensifiers and How Do They Work?

Tanning bed intensifiers are products designed to enhance the tanning process by improving skin hydration and increasing the absorption of ultraviolet (UV) light. They do not contain SPF and are not substitutes for sun protection.

  1. Types of Tanning Bed Intensifiers:
    – Moisturizing Intensifiers
    – Bronzing Intensifiers
    – Delayed Action Intensifiers
    – High-Performance Intensifiers

Tanning Bed Intensifiers Diversity:
Tanning bed intensifiers come in various formulations and features, appealing to different tanning goals and preferences. Each type serves a specific purpose, with various ingredients aimed at achieving optimal tanning results and skin care.

  1. Moisturizing Intensifiers:
    Moisturizing intensifiers improve skin hydration and elasticity. These products often contain ingredients like aloe vera, vitamin E, or hyaluronic acid, which support the skin’s health. Well-hydrated skin helps to achieve a deeper tan by allowing UV rays to penetrate effectively. According to research by the American Academy of Dermatology (AAD), hydrated skin can lead to better tanning results and minimizes the risk of peeling.

  2. Bronzing Intensifiers:
    Bronzing intensifiers provide instant color to the skin while enhancing the tanning process. They often contain bronzers, such as DHA (dihydroxyacetone), which reacts with skin proteins to produce a temporary darkening effect. These bronzers can give a tan appearance before the skin fully develops its color. Studies from the Journal of Clinical and Aesthetic Dermatology (2012) demonstrate that bronzing agents can boost client satisfaction in tanning salons.

  3. Delayed Action Intensifiers:
    Delayed action intensifiers are designed to maximize tanning results over time. These products may contain tyrosine or other ingredients that stimulate melanin production in the skin. Increased melanin levels lead to a deeper, longer-lasting tan. Research in the Journal of Cosmetic Dermatology (2019) has shown that regular use of such intensifiers can significantly contribute to improved tanning outcomes in controlled settings.

  4. High-Performance Intensifiers:
    High-performance intensifiers are formulated with premium ingredients for tanning enthusiasts looking for advanced results. These may include antioxidants, skin-softening agents, or specialized blends to enhance skin health and tanning efficacy. A study published in the Journal of Drugs in Dermatology (2020) found that certain high-performance formulations could improve both the short-term tanning effects and the long-term appearance of skin texture and tone.

Which Ingredients Enhance the Effectiveness of Tanning Bed Intensifiers?

The ingredients that enhance the effectiveness of tanning bed intensifiers typically include natural extracts, vitamins, and specific compounds that promote melanin production.

  1. Tyrosine
  2. DHA (Dihydroxyacetone)
  3. Aloe Vera
  4. Vitamin E
  5. Olive Oil
  6. Green Tea Extract
  7. Carrot Seed Oil
  8. Dark tanning agents
  9. Bronzing agents
  10. Fragrance and moisturizing ingredients

These ingredients play distinct roles in tanning, and their effectiveness can depend on various factors. Each ingredient contributes differently to skin hydration, pigmentation, and overall tanning acceleration.

  1. Tyrosine: Tyrosine is an amino acid that stimulates melanin production in the skin. Melanin is responsible for skin pigmentation. Research from the American Academy of Dermatology indicates that tyrosine may enhance tanning outcomes when used in conjunction with UV exposure.

  2. DHA (Dihydroxyacetone): DHA is a colorless sugar that interacts chemically with amino acids in the skin’s surface, leading to a tanned appearance. It is a well-known ingredient in self-tanners. A 2018 study published in the Journal of Dermatological Treatment supports its effective use in improving skin color in response to tanning.

  3. Aloe Vera: Aloe Vera is renowned for its skin-soothing properties. It hydrates and heals the skin, helping to prolong the tanning effects. Its use is backed by various studies indicating its effectiveness in improving skin structure and health.

  4. Vitamin E: Vitamin E is an antioxidant that helps protect skin cells from damage caused by UV exposure. The Journal of Clinical and Aesthetic Dermatology (2016) explains that it can also improve skin hydration and reduce peeling after sun exposure.

  5. Olive Oil: Olive Oil is known for its moisturizing properties. It helps in maintaining hydration levels during tanning. According to research in the International Journal of Cosmetic Science, it can also enhance skin elasticity which aids in achieving a more even tan.

  6. Green Tea Extract: Green Tea Extract contains polyphenols that protect against UV damage and may help with skin repair. Studies, including one in Photodermatology, Photoimmunology & Photomedicine (2017), suggest it could offer protective benefits while tanning.

  7. Carrot Seed Oil: Carrot Seed Oil is rich in beta-carotene, which can enhance skin pigmentation. A review in the Journal of Food Science (2019) highlighted its potential benefits for skin health and pigmentation.

  8. Dark Tanning Agents: Dark tanning agents include synthetic pigments that can give an instant tan. Some users prefer these for immediate results, although opinions vary regarding their safety.

  9. Bronzing Agents: Bronzing agents add color to the skin without UV exposure. Their use is supported by many personal testimonials, although some users express concerns about fading quickly.

  10. Fragrance and Moisturizing Ingredients: These ingredients improve the sensory experience of using the product and may condition the skin. While opinions on their necessity vary, many users appreciate a pleasant scent and hydrated skin during tanning.

How Can You Select the Right Tanning Bed Intensifier for Your Skin Tone?

Choosing the right tanning bed intensifier for your skin tone involves understanding your skin type, the desired tanning results, and the ingredients in the product.

Skin type: Identifying your skin tone is crucial. Fair skin typically requires low-intensity products with hydrating ingredients. Darker skin tones can use stronger formulations to enhance tanning results. A study by the American Academy of Dermatology (Smith et al., 2022) states that individuals with lighter skin are more susceptible to overexposure, making careful selection essential.

Desired results: Consider what you aim to achieve from tanning. If you desire a deep bronze, select an intensifier with DHA, which darkens the skin chemically. For a gradual tan, opt for a product featuring natural bronzers. According to research published in the Journal of Cosmetic Dermatology (Johnson & Lee, 2023), products with bronzers can provide instant results but may require more frequent applications.

Ingredient knowledge: Familiarize yourself with the main components of tanning bed intensifiers. Key ingredients include:

  • DHA (Dihydroxyacetone): A common ingredient that provides a sun-kissed glow by reacting with the amino acids in your skin.
  • Aloe Vera: Hydrates and soothes the skin, preventing dryness during tanning.
  • Hemp seed oil: Nourishes the skin with essential fatty acids, promoting an even tan.

Research indicates that moisturized skin absorbs tanning products more effectively (Thompson et al., 2021).

application method: Assess how the tanning intensifier is best applied. Some products are lotions, while others are oils or sprays. Lotions are generally favored for their ease of application and even coverage. Oil-based products may provide added moisture but can be slippery during application, requiring careful handling.

Patch test: It is wise to conduct a patch test before widespread use. This determines any adverse reactions. Apply a small amount of the product on a less visible area of skin. Wait for 24 hours to confirm no irritation occurs.

By evaluating these factors, you can select a tanning bed intensifier that matches your skin tone and meets your tanning goals effectively.

Are There Any Potential Risks of Using Tanning Bed Intensifiers?

Yes, there are potential risks associated with using tanning bed intensifiers. These products often contain chemicals designed to enhance tanning results, but they may also cause adverse skin reactions or other health issues.

Tanning bed intensifiers are mostly used to complement the effects of ultraviolet (UV) light from tanning beds. They typically contain ingredients such as bronzers, moisturizers, and skin-enhancing compounds. However, not all intensifiers work the same way. For instance, bronzers can provide temporary color and often contain dyes, while moisturizers offer hydration to promote skin health. Some intensifiers may include tanning accelerators, which claim to speed up melanin production, while others focus solely on moisturizing benefits.

On a positive note, tanning bed intensifiers can promote a deeper tan and improve skin hydration. In fact, products containing moisturizers can help maintain skin elasticity by avoiding dryness, which is especially important after UV exposure. According to a study by the Skin Cancer Foundation, some tanning products may help moisture retention and potentially enhance the overall tanning experience when used appropriately.

However, there are negative aspects to consider. Some intensifiers contain ingredients that can cause allergic reactions or skin irritations, such as fragrances or artificial colorants. The American Academy of Dermatology warns about the increased risk of skin damage from prolonged UV exposure, heightened by the use of certain tanning products. Additionally, overuse of tanning beds can lead to skin issues, including premature aging and an increased risk of skin cancer.

When using tanning bed intensifiers, consider the following recommendations: Test a small area of skin for reactions prior to full application. Choose products that are hypoallergenic and free from artificial fragrances and colors. Also, limit tanning bed sessions to avoid excessive UV exposure. Always follow safety guidelines and consider discussing your tanning habits with a dermatologist to ensure optimal skin health.

What Best Practices Should You Follow When Using Tanning Bed Intensifiers?

The best practices for using tanning bed intensifiers include selecting appropriate products and using them correctly to enhance tanning effectiveness and skin health.

  1. Choose the right intensifier type.
  2. Perform a patch test for allergies.
  3. Apply evenly to all areas.
  4. Follow manufacturer’s instructions.
  5. Limit usage time in the tanning bed.
  6. Maintain skin hydration.
  7. Avoid intensifiers with harmful ingredients.

The above points highlight important considerations when using tanning bed intensifiers. Understanding each practice ensures safe and effective tanning.

  1. Choose the Right Intensifier Type:
    Choosing the right intensifier type is essential for maximizing tanning results. Intensifiers vary in formulation and purpose. Some products focus on enhancing melanin production, while others provide moisturization or bronzing effects. Selecting an intensifier that meets your skin type and tanning goals is crucial. For example, a product designed for sensitive skin may use fewer chemicals and natural ingredients.

  2. Perform a Patch Test for Allergies:
    Performing a patch test for allergies helps to identify any adverse reactions. Before applying a new intensifier on a large area, apply a small amount on your wrist or inner arm. This can alert you to any potential irritants in the product. Studies have shown that people with sensitive skin are more prone to reactions when using products with fragrances or preservatives.

  3. Apply Evenly to All Areas:
    Applying evenly to all areas ensures consistent tanning results. Uneven application can lead to streaking or splotchy tanning. Use a small amount and spread it thinly and uniformly over the skin. Consider utilizing an applicator glove for better control and even coverage. Research indicates that proper application decreases the likelihood of uneven tanning and skin irritation.

  4. Follow Manufacturer’s Instructions:
    Following the manufacturer’s instructions is vital for product effectiveness and safety. Each product may have specific guidelines regarding application methods, timing, and compatibility with tanning beds. Ignoring these instructions may lead to suboptimal results or skin damage. Research shows that misuse of tanning products can lead to severe skin reactions or increased skin sensitivity.

  5. Limit Usage Time in the Tanning Bed:
    Limiting usage time in the tanning bed minimizes the risk of skin overexposure. Extended exposure can lead to burns or long-term skin damage. It is advisable to refer to the tanning bed’s recommended exposure time along with the intensifier’s guidelines. A 2014 study published in the Journal of Dermatological Science indicates that moderating tanning sessions can help balance desired results while reducing health risks.

  6. Maintain Skin Hydration:
    Maintaining skin hydration is essential for optimal tanning results. Well-hydrated skin absorbs tanning products better and looks healthier. After tanning, use a moisturizer to prevent dryness and peeling. Research suggests that hydrated skin enhances the overall appearance of tans and contributes to the longevity of the tanning effect.

  7. Avoid Intensifiers with Harmful Ingredients:
    Avoiding intensifiers with harmful ingredients is critical for skin health. Ingredients like parabens, synthetic fragrances, and certain alcohols can cause irritation and long-term skin issues. Always check labels for harmful additives, as many brands now offer formulations that are free from common irritants. The Environmental Working Group (EWG) warns against chemical ingredients that may pose health concerns over time.

By implementing these best practices, users can safely and effectively enhance their tanning experience while protecting their skin.
